Abstract

We have been developing a software development environment using the program diagram “Hichart”. In our research, we have implemented a graphical editor for Hichart. We add new features and capabilities to the editor, including calculation of a cyclomatic complexity and generation of SVG files for a given Hichart diagram. In this paper, we present a method of automatically generating a SVG file for a given program diagram based on attribute graph grammars. The thus obtained SVG file can animate a process of calculating a cyclomatic complexity of a given Hichart diagram on any readily available Web browsers. We also describe an automatic generation of a SVG file which can be displayed when diagrams are aesthetically drawn.
